by SnowMiser on 3/6/101st Mariner Arena - BaltimoreThis was my first time watching an indoor soccer game and my first time to 1st Mariner Arena. I would describe it as a cross between European soccer and professional hockey. I enjoyed it very much. As for the facility, the bathrooms and common areas were clean, the concessions were predictably over priced, and the staff was polite, pleasant, highly visible, helpful and accomodating. The seating, however, was really tiny. People were squeezed in like sardines. Thankfully the event wasn't sold out so we could spread out a bit. Favorite Moment: The ball was kicked out of bounds, which means it landed in the stands, since the field is the size of a hockey rink. It headed right towards a lady who was chatting and not paying attention to the game. Her companion saw it and snatched it out of the air a split second before it beaned her in the head.
